titleOfInvention |
System and method for detecting explosive agents using swir, mwir, and lwir hyperspectral imaging |
abstract |
A system and method for hyperspectral imaging to detect hazardous agents including explosive agents. A system comprising a tunable laser, a collection optics, and one or more hyperspectral imaging detectors configured for hyperspectral imaging of a target comprising an unknown material. A method comprising illuminating a target comprising an unknown material via a tunable laser to thereby generate a plurality of interacted photons. Detecting said interacted photons to generate at least one hyperspectral image representative of the target. One or more hyperspectral images may be obtained including SWIR, MWIR, and LWIR hyperspectral images. Algorithms and chemometric techniques may be applied to assess the hyperspectral images to identify the unknown material as comprising an explosive agent or a non-explosive agent. A video imaging device may also be configured to provide a video image of an area of interest, which may be assessed to identify a target for interrogation using hyperspectral imaging. |
